Abstinence

Abstinence means doing without something. People choose not to have sex for many reasons:

  • Just don’t feel ready
  • Moral and/or religious values
  • It would upset parents
  • Wanting to wait until marriage
  • Protection from STDs, HIV/AIDS, and pregnancy
  • Had sex already and felt it was a mistake

Abstinence isn’t forever—it just means a person has decided to wait. Other ways to show affection and share closeness are: talking, holding hands, hugging, and kissing.

TIPS
When you have decided to abstain from sex, these tips might help you to maintain your decision if you are placed in situations in which you feel threatened:

  • Set your personal limits- what you will and will not do in a relationship
  • Discuss your feelings with your partner
  • Learn to say NO and mean it
  • Don’t use alcohol or other drugs that make it hard to say NO or stay in control
